Automatic Constant Feed Speed Control: Automatic output voltage adjustment in real-time to ensure constant preset feed speed regardless of weight change of the workpieces. Automatic Frequency Adjustment: Automatic output frequency adjustment in real-time to make sure the load is always working at its resonant frequency. Automatic Resonant Frequency Search: Search out and output the resonant frequency of the load. other related parameters are also set automatically Counting: Count the number of the workpieces. The controller will slow down or stop when counting up to the preset value. (available on SDVC34MRJ) Rs485 Communication: All parameters of the controller can be adjusted via R485. Automatic Switch Sensor Type Recognition: The controller can recognize and adapt to both PNP and NPN-type switch sensors Sync Output: Sync the output waveform of the slave controller with that of the master controller to the same frequency and phase to avoid the beat effect Overvoltage Protection: If the input voltage is too high, the power supply of the controller will be shut down automatically to protect itself. Digital Overheat Protection: If the internal temperature of the controller gets too high, the controller will stop its output to protect itself. Overcurrent Protection: If output current exceeds its rated value the controller will stop its output to protect itself and the load. Restorable Short Circuit Protection: If the output of the controller is short-circuited, the controller will shut down its output to protect itself and the load. But the fuse inside will not be blown. So when there is no short circuit at the output side, the controller will work again after power is on.
Frequency Adjustment: The output frequency of the controller can be manually adjusted to the resonant frequency of the vibratory feeder to get smooth, quiet, and energy saving feed effect Automatic High Precision Voltage Requlation: The internal digital voltage regulation circuit can eliminate feed sped variation caused by mains voltage fluctuation. Time Adjustable Soft Start: The controller will increase output voltage from 0 to the preset value when powered on to avoid a sudden shake. soft start time can be digitally preset Switch Sensor ON/OFF Control NPN switch sensor or PLc can be connected to turn on/off the controller. Photoelectric Sensor ON/OFF Control: The cuH inteligent Photoelectric sensor can be connected to turn on/off the controller.Remote speed Control. The output voltage of the controller can be adjusted remotely by an external potentiometer, a Plc, or a 1-5v DC signal. DC Control Output: The controller can output low voltage DC power asociated with ON/0ff Control of the controller to drive a solenoid or other external devices.Keypad Lock: Lock all buttons on the keypad to prevent misoperation by pressing the ON/Off button and hold
1. Solar panels' output voltage are less than 60VDC, which decreases the risk of an electrical fire. 2. One panel would match one MPPT, increasing 5-15% power in production compared to string inverters. 3. Keeping each panel working individually avoids the impact of partial shadows on the entire solar system. 4. Independently tracking each of the solar panels' production makes it easy to identify each solar panel's performance. 5. Lightweight and compact with plug-and-play connectors, it is easy to install. 6. Monitor the running station anytime, anywhere, using the app. 7. The microinverter housing is designed for outdoor installation and complies with the IP67 protection rating.
